General annotation (Comments)

Function

Catalyzes the synthesis of GMP from XMP By similarity. HAMAP MF_00345

Catalytic activity

ATP + xanthosine 5'-phosphate + L-glutamine + H2O = AMP + diphosphate + GMP + L-glutamate. HAMAP MF_00345

Pathway

Purine metabolism; GMP biosynthesis; GMP from XMP (L-Gln route): step 1/1. HAMAP MF_00345

Subunit structure

Heterodimer composed of a glutamine amidotransferase subunit (A) and a GMP-binding subunit (B) Potential. HAMAP MF_00345

Sequence similarities

Contains 1 GMP-binding domain.
